What Does a a Supplemental Insurance Agent in Monterey Cost?
Costs for supplemental insurance in California vary by plan type, age, and location. Medigap Plan G premiums for a 65-year-old in Monterey typically range from $120 to $250 per month. Medicare Advantage plans may have $0 premiums but include copays and deductibles. This is general information, not insurance advice.
About supplemental insurance agents in Monterey
Supplemental insurance agents in Monterey, California help residents find plans that cover gaps in Original Medicare. California law allows a Medigap Open Enrollment Period when you turn 65, during which insurers cannot deny coverage or charge more due to health conditions. Agents in Monterey can explain local plan options from carriers like Anthem Blue Cross and Blue Shield of California.
Frequently Asked Questions
What is the best time to buy a Medigap plan in Monterey?
The best time is during your Medigap Open Enrollment Period. This period starts the first month you are 65 and enrolled in Medicare Part B. In California, you have six months to buy any Medigap policy without medical underwriting.
Do California laws protect my right to change Medigap plans?
Yes. California has a birthday rule that allows you to switch to a similar or lesser Medigap plan within 60 days of your birthday without health questions. This rule applies to plans from the same or another insurance company.
Can a supplemental insurance agent help with Medicare Advantage plans in Monterey?
Yes. Many supplemental insurance agents also sell Medicare Advantage plans. These plans are an alternative to Original Medicare and often include prescription drug coverage. Agents can compare plans available in Monterey County.
